Service Activities

As the VISTA member at Community Connections, you will help with the development and delivery of support services for people with disabilities and seniors by working to improve and diversify Community Connections’ fundraising systems. Your duties will include: researching available grants and funding resources available for human service organizations; applying for grant funding; developing systems and infrastructure for implementing community events that raise awareness about our services and raise funds to support those services; creating marketing materials to launch a new legacy endowment fund; and improving donor management systems for maintaining contact with donors, tracking existing donor contributions and targeted outreach to new donors

Community Need Addressed

Community Connections is based in Ketchikan Alaska and serves people with disabilities, seniors and children in several other island communities in Southeast Alaska. Our small community is a friendly island town that is home for artists, outdoor enthusiasts, anglers, and a vibrant Alaska Native community. Wildlife is abundant in this cool, rainy climate. During the summers, average temperatures may vary from 46 to 70 degrees! Precipitation is always possible. Ketchikan is far from any larger city and accessible only by boat or plane. When Community Connections was founded in 1985, local resources for individuals with developmental disabilities were limited and parents were often forced to move or put their loved ones into institutional care.

Community Connections believes that person-centered and community-based services are the best path to success and satisfaction for individuals with developmental disabilities and anyone needing services to remain in their home community. Due to funding cuts by the State of Alaska grant and Medicaid programs, many low-income people including people with disabilities and seniors have had services reduced, or have been thrown out of services entirely. In order to offset these cuts, Community Connections must diversify our funding streams. Diversified funding will help us to fill in the gaps in home and community-based services that the State no longer covers, and will allow us to maintain the level of service we currently provide to disadvantaged individuals in these remote Southeast Alaska communities
